Output b0363848045a2139e0ef627a197fdb7512195d7a3968372dff95b92f8a20083f:0

value
2785591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23560ad450afdf2435f794f018b5265585094c36 OP_EQUAL
address
34ureahN1tXDCawbewXCpHbJznSramuWXa
transaction
b0363848045a2139e0ef627a197fdb7512195d7a3968372dff95b92f8a20083f
spent
true